S&C Electric Company is seeking a dynamic individual to coordinate our maintenance function. As a mold technician , you’ll be crucial in ensuring smooth operations and supporting our diverse team. In this job you will work on a variety of production equipment and process systems in our manufacturing facility. This work includes preventive maintenance, troubleshooting and repair to support a wide variety of equipment, accessories and components used in the molding, Dispensing and, assembly, of our products. You will perform maintenance tasks utilizing equipment manuals, assembly drawings, electrical, hydraulic and pneumatic schematics. You will assist in the further development of preventive maintenance programs through the performance and refinement of maintenance tasks. You will be expected to interact professionally with all members of the team as well as all customers by following all documented company and departmental procedures. You must be willing to do overtime or hours other than the assigned shift when agreed upon, including scheduled or emergency overtime.

Requirements

  • Ability to navigate manufacturer preventive maintenance and repair manuals.
  • Proficiency with shop math, hand tools and various measuring instruments.
  • Fundamental understanding of applicable OSHA safety regulations.
  • High School Diploma or GED.

Nice To Haves

  • Prior experience performing equipment rebuilds and upgrades is desirable.
  • Demonstrate the ability to understand mechanical drawings of assemblies.
  • Knowledge of mold machines or polymer product.
  • Forklift experience: on a standup / set down.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ot and repair fabrication, Molding, Dispensing, assembly equipment without limiting equipment uptime requirements.
  • Perform test and analysis tasks using various measuring tools such as calipers or micrometers and train to use Hardness test equipment.
  • Use a variety of hand and power tools along with machine specific tools to perform preventative maintenance and repair tasks.
  • Make equipment replacement parts using conventional machines such as mills, lathes and grinders.
  • Identify necessary parts for repair and PM via OEM manuals and maintenance manuals.
  • Obtain necessary parts for repair and PM by follow ing appropriate stockroom procedures.
  • Communicate status of work orders to team leadership, including proper documentation.
  • Exercise good judgment in analyzing test results and implementing appropriate corrective action or repairs.
  • Maintain continuity among techs by documenting and communicating actions taken, irregularities found and observations to follow up on previous work and enable root cause determination.
  • Maintain a safe and clean working environment by complying with health and safety procedures, rules, and regulations.
  • Work at various heights and in confined spaces that may include exposure to process chemicals, dirt, oil and grease.
